Left vs. Right End Caps - How to Determine:
Stand facing the gutter with your back to the house:
Left End Cap (L)
The cap that goes on your LEFT side when facing the gutter. Used to close the left end of a gutter run.
Right End Cap (R)
The cap that goes on your RIGHT side when facing the gutter. Used to close the right end of a gutter run.
Pro Tip: Most complete gutter runs require one of each, which is why the Pair option is the most popular choice. If you are ordering single caps for repair, identify which end has failed before ordering.
Installation Guide - Contractors and DIY:
- Confirm orientation: Identify which end needs a left cap and which needs a right cap before installation
- Prepare the gutter end: Remove debris, old sealant, and oxidation. Wipe dry with a clean cloth
- Apply sealant: Run a bead of 100% silicone or gutter sealant around the inside perimeter of the end cap
- Seat the end cap: Press firmly onto the open gutter end, ensuring full contact around the entire perimeter
- Wipe excess sealant: Clean away any squeeze-out for a professional appearance
- Optional rivets: For high-wind zones, secure with two 1/8-inch aluminum pop rivets through the end cap face
- Exterior bead: Apply a finishing bead of sealant around the outside seam and smooth with a gloved finger
- Allow cure time: Wait minimum 24 hours before exposure to rain or water testing
Safety note: Gutter work requires a stable ladder. Use OSHA-compliant fall protection equipment when working at heights of 6 feet or more. Professional installation recommended for multi-story homes.

Frequently Asked Questions:
Q: What size gutters do these end caps fit?
A: These end caps fit 5-inch K-style (5K) gutters, the most common residential gutter profile in the United States. They are not compatible with 6-inch K-style, half-round, or fascia-style gutters.
Q: Why use aluminum end caps instead of plastic?
A: Aluminum end caps outlast plastic by decades. Plastic becomes brittle with UV exposure and cracks during freeze-thaw cycles. Aluminum expands at the same rate as the gutter, eliminating differential expansion leaks.
Q: What is the difference between left and right end caps?
A: Stand facing the gutter with your back to the house. The cap on your left is a left cap, and the cap on your right is a right cap. Most gutter runs require one of each.
Q: What sealant should I use?
A: Use 100% silicone sealant rated for metal or a dedicated gutter sealant. Apply to both the inside perimeter before installation and around the outside seam after. Allow 24 hours cure time.
